TURN-208: Gatevale turnstile counters at the Merrow Field pilot double-count when a rotation reverses mid-cycle. Attendance totals drift roughly 2% high per event. The debounce window fix is implemented, reviewed by Ilsa, and soak-tested across two simulated match days without drift. Ready for your cut; the candidate build is identified below.

trace token, tagag-tafog: htk6_5ed18c

Onboarding note for the Ledgerpane admin table: bulk edits are applied through the batcher service, not directly against the database. Select rows, choose an action, and the batcher stages changes in a pending set you can review before commit. Edits over 500 rows require a second approver — this is enforced server-side, so don't try to chunk around it. To run the batcher locally you need the staging write credential, which goes in your .env as the next line.

secret setting of bahip-kagag: RELAY_SECRET3=c83

## Provenance: Pairlane Matcher GC Pauses

Support: long match delays usually mean GC pauses in the Pairlane matcher, not user error. Fixes shipped via the Corven build system, which stamps each artifact. Before filing a ticket, check that production runs the patched build. The stamp for the current release follows.

pipeline stamp: htk9_6ce9d33c5

Handover Note — Warranty Overrun on the Braxen Line

Hi — welcome to the hot seat. Short version: warranty claims on the Braxen HD units are running about forty percent over forecast, mostly a seal failure traced to a supplier change last spring. Remediation kits are shipping, and Ottery's team in Quality has the root-cause work nearly wrapped. Budget-wise we've absorbed it so far, but Q3 will be tight, so watch the reserve. Dealer comms are drafted and waiting on your sign-off. The strategic backdrop is in the note below.

internal memo for hahif-hahaf: Headcount on the Zorwyn team goes from 9 to 100 by the end of October. Gross margin on Zorwyn came in at 5 percent against a plan of 10 percent.

## Onboarding: Farebranch Rules Engine

Plugin authors integrate with Farebranch by registering fee rules against the evaluation API. Rules are sandboxed; they cannot perform network calls directly. All rate-table lookups go through the host, which validates your plugin manifest at load time. Your local env file must include the signing credential the host uses to verify manifests, set on the next line.

secret setting of bajef-fajof: COURIER_KEY3=76c